Dear [Recipient's Name], I hope this letter finds you well. I am writing to request additional information about Oklahoma, as I did not find the details I am seeking in your brochure. I am particularly interested in understanding the various attractions and activities available in Oklahoma, as well as any notable events or festivals that take place throughout the year. Furthermore, I believe that these details will greatly assist me in planning my upcoming trip to your beautiful state. My main objective is to gain a comprehensive understanding of Oklahoma's unique offerings, enabling me to make informed decisions about what to see and do during my visit. As a result, I kindly request any brochures, pamphlets, or other informative materials that you may possess regarding tourism in Oklahoma. Any insider tips or local recommendations would also be greatly appreciated. In terms of specific areas of interest, I am particularly keen on exploring the natural wonders that Oklahoma has to offer. I am intrigued by the state's diverse landscapes, including its stunning national parks, lakes, and scenic drives. Therefore, any in-depth descriptions or itineraries for exploring these natural attractions would be extremely helpful. Furthermore, I am an avid history enthusiast and would love to learn more about Oklahoma's rich cultural heritage. If there are any historical landmarks, museums, or historical societies that showcase the state's past, please include information about them in your response. Additionally, I would be thrilled to receive any information about Native American culture, as I understand that Oklahoma has a significant Indigenous population and boasts several fascinating cultural sites. Lastly, if there are any events or festivals happening in Oklahoma during the time of my visit, I would greatly appreciate details about those as well. Whether it's music festivals, art exhibitions, or food fairs, I am eager to immerse myself in the local culture and experience the vibrant atmosphere that Oklahoma has to offer. Once again, I want to thank you in advance for your time and assistance. I am truly excited about my upcoming trip and believe that your help will greatly enhance my Oklahoma experience. I look forward to receiving the requested information and eagerly anticipate the prospect of exploring the wonders of Oklahoma. Warm regards, [Your Name]

To make an open records request in Oklahoma, identify the specific records you want and draft a request letter. Using the Oklahoma Sample Letter for Request for Information not in Brochure can help you structure your request effectively. Submit your request to the appropriate agency, ensuring you include necessary details such as dates and types of records. Keep a copy of your request for your records.
